Job Overview

A law firm in Middletown, NJ, is seeking an Associate Attorney with 1-4 years of general litigation experience to join its civil defense litigation practice. This role involves handling a variety of legal matters, including court appearances, drafting legal documents, and participating in negotiations and settlements. The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ical and communication skills, with the ability to work independently and within a team.

Duties

  • Gather evidence, evaluate findings, and develop legal strategies and arguments.
  • Make court appearances and present cases.
  • Draft motion papers, appellate briefs, and other legal documents.
  • Conduct bench trials and negotiate settlements.
  • Work both independently and as part of a team to complete legal projects.

Requirements

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Licensed to practice law in New Jersey (NY/PA Bar admissions are a plus).
  • Ability to stay organized and meet deadlines.
